Krista Alessandri of Flemington Named to Dean's List at Widener University

2013 Jan 9

Krista Alessandri of Flemington, N.J., who is studying early years/special education at Widener University in Chester, Pa., was named to the Dean's List for the fall 2012 semester at Widener.

The Dean's List recognizes full-time students who earned a grade point average of 3.50 and above for the semester.

Widener University is a private, metropolitan university that connects curricula to social issues through civic engagement. Dynamic teaching, active scholarship, personal attention, leadership development, and experiential learning are key components of the Widener experience. A comprehensive doctorate-granting university, Widener is comprised of eight schools and colleges that offer liberal arts and sciences, professional and pre-professional curricula leading to associate's, baccalaureate, master's and doctoral degrees. The university's campuses in Chester, Exton, and Harrisburg, Pa., and Wilmington, Del., serve some 6,500 students. Visit the university website, www.widener.edu.
